เหตุผลที่เจ้าของเว็บไซต์ใช้แพลตฟอร์มฐานข้อมูล MongoDB

เผยแพร่แล้ว: 2019-10-04

วันนี้ data ถือเป็นสินทรัพย์สำหรับธุรกิจ เมื่อธุรกิจมีเว็บไซต์ เว็บไซต์ก็ให้บริการตามวัตถุประสงค์หลายประการ ประการแรก เว็บไซต์กลายเป็นศูนย์กลางของกิจกรรมการซื้อขายออนไลน์ ผู้ซื้อที่สนใจสามารถซื้อสินค้าได้โดยตรงทางออนไลน์ ผู้ซื้อที่สนใจสามารถดูสินค้าหรือบริการต่างๆ และสั่งซื้อได้ตลอดเวลาเพื่อความสะดวก ลักษณะการทำงานอื่นรวมถึงการรวบรวมข้อมูล เมื่อมีผู้เยี่ยมชมเว็บไซต์ แพลตฟอร์มเว็บจะรวบรวมข้อมูลจากผู้เยี่ยมชมรายนั้น จากข้อมูลที่รวบรวมนี้ ผู้เข้าชมให้การตั้งค่าบนเว็บไซต์ ด้วยข้อมูลที่รวบรวมดังกล่าว ประสบการณ์ของผู้ใช้บนแพลตฟอร์มเว็บไซต์สามารถปรับปรุงได้

ดังนั้น ข้อมูลจึงมีความสำคัญสำหรับธุรกิจออนไลน์ ต้องรวบรวมข้อมูลแล้วต้องจัดเก็บข้อมูลในลักษณะที่ปลอดภัย เมื่อพูดถึงฐานข้อมูล MongoDB คุณต้องคำนึงถึงบางสิ่ง แทนที่จะใช้แพลตฟอร์มฐานข้อมูลทั่วไป การใช้แพลตฟอร์มฐานข้อมูลนี้มีประโยชน์บางประการ ผลประโยชน์เหล่านี้จะกล่าวถึงด้านล่าง ฐานข้อมูล MongoDB สามารถให้ประโยชน์ดังต่อไปนี้แก่ผู้ใช้

  1. ทริกเกอร์และขั้นตอนการจัดเก็บ

สำหรับบางคน ฐานข้อมูลเป็นเพียงแพลตฟอร์มสำหรับการจัดเก็บข้อมูล แนวคิดนี้เริ่มเก่าแล้ว เนื่องจากแพลตฟอร์มฐานข้อมูลไม่ได้มีไว้สำหรับจัดเก็บข้อมูลเท่านั้น ควรทำงานเหมือนแอปพลิเคชันที่มาพร้อมกับการส่งออก CSV ทริกเกอร์ กระบวนงานที่เก็บไว้ ฯลฯ แทนที่จะเป็นแพลตฟอร์มฐานข้อมูลเชิงสัมพันธ์ คุณจำเป็นต้องใช้ฐานข้อมูล MongoDB ด้วยเหตุผลนี้ ด้วยแพลตฟอร์มฐานข้อมูลนี้ คุณจะได้รับคุณสมบัติต่างๆ เช่น เก็บข้อมูล ทริกเกอร์ ฯลฯ การมีคุณสมบัติหรือสิ่งอำนวยความสะดวกเหล่านี้ช่วยผู้จัดการฐานข้อมูลอย่างมาก ดังนั้น หากคุณกำลังมองหาโซลูชันการจัดการฐานข้อมูลร่วมสมัย นี่คือตัวเลือกที่เหมาะสมสำหรับคุณ

  1. การเปลี่ยนแปลงสคีมาด้วยฐานข้อมูล

การเปลี่ยนแปลงแบบแผนเป็นสิ่งที่คนส่วนใหญ่ไม่รัก อย่างไรก็ตาม การเปลี่ยนแปลงสคีมาก็มีความสำคัญในขณะเดียวกัน ดังนั้นคุณควรทำอย่างไรในสถานการณ์เช่นนี้? การใช้ฐานข้อมูล MongoDB อาจเป็นวิธีแก้ปัญหา มีรูปแบบที่เรียบง่ายของคุณลักษณะที่ช่วยคุณในการเปลี่ยนแปลงสคีมา แพลตฟอร์มการจัดการฐานข้อมูลนี้ทำงานเหมือนกับแอปพลิเคชัน ซึ่งทำให้ขั้นตอนการเปลี่ยนแปลงสคีมาเรียบง่ายและมีประสิทธิภาพ ในยุคปัจจุบัน คุณไม่สามารถแยกแยะการเปลี่ยนแปลงสคีมาสำหรับเว็บไซต์ของคุณได้ คุณต้องนับมัน และนั่นคือเหตุผลที่คุณต้องการฐานข้อมูล MongoDB ทำให้ฐานข้อมูล MongoDB ใช้งานง่าย

  1. ฐานข้อมูลที่รับรองความปลอดภัยที่ดีขึ้น

การรักษาความปลอดภัยของข้อมูลถือเป็นส่วนสำคัญของการจัดการฐานข้อมูลมาโดยตลอด แพลตฟอร์มฐานข้อมูลต้องได้รับการรักษาความปลอดภัย มิฉะนั้นจะไม่สามารถใช้แพลตฟอร์มฐานข้อมูลได้ ไม่ว่าจะนำเสนอฟีเจอร์ที่ไม่ซ้ำใครและน่าตื่นเต้นมากมายเพียงใด แพลตฟอร์มฐานข้อมูลก็เป็นที่รู้จักเสมอถึงประโยชน์ในการจัดหาพื้นที่จัดเก็บที่ปลอดภัย ในปัจจุบันนี้ การรักษาความปลอดภัยมีความสำคัญมาก เนื่องจากการรักษาความปลอดภัยได้กลายเป็นข้อกังวลอย่างแท้จริงสำหรับเจ้าของเว็บไซต์

การขโมยข้อมูล การขุด การแฮ็ก และฟิชชิ่งเป็นภัยคุกคามหลัก คุณอาจพบภัยคุกคามอื่นๆ เช่น มัลแวร์ สปายแวร์ ฯลฯ ร่วมกับพวกเขา ในการหลีกเลี่ยงภัยคุกคามเหล่านี้ คุณต้องมีแพลตฟอร์มฐานข้อมูลที่ปลอดภัย ด้วยแพลตฟอร์มฐานข้อมูล MongoDB คุณสามารถบรรลุสิ่งนั้นได้อย่างสมบูรณ์แบบ แพลตฟอร์มฐานข้อมูลนี้มีคุณสมบัติขั้นสูงมากมาย ทำให้การจัดการฐานข้อมูลเป็นไปอย่างราบรื่นและใช้งานง่าย แต่สิ่งที่น่าสนใจที่สุดคือการรักษาความปลอดภัยฐานข้อมูลที่ยอดเยี่ยม หากต้องการทราบข้อมูลเพิ่มเติม คุณสามารถตรวจสอบ RemoteDBA.com

  1. ความพร้อมใช้งานสูงและความล้มเหลว

ด้วยแพลตฟอร์มฐานข้อมูลเชิงสัมพันธ์จำนวนมาก มีข้อสังเกตว่ามีตัวเลือกที่จำกัดหรือไม่มีเลยสำหรับการจัดการการจำลองแบบและเฟลโอเวอร์ ตัวอย่างเช่น สามารถพิจารณา PostgreSQL แพลตฟอร์มการจัดการฐานข้อมูลนี้ได้รับความนิยม แม้ว่าจะมีข้อเสียเปรียบที่สำคัญ ปัจจุบันนี้มาพร้อมกับระบบการจำลองแบบง่าย ๆ ซึ่งไม่มีคุณลักษณะเฟลโอเวอร์เลย เพื่อช่วยเหลือผู้ใช้ มีเครื่องมือบางอย่างที่มาพร้อมกับคุณสมบัติดังกล่าวสำหรับ PostgreSQL อย่างไรก็ตาม เครื่องมือเหล่านี้มีความซับซ้อน ผู้ใช้บางคนไม่สามารถใช้งานได้ เนื่องจากมีปัญหาเกี่ยวกับความเป็นมิตรต่อผู้ใช้ของเครื่องมือเหล่านี้

เมื่อแพลตฟอร์มฐานข้อมูลเชิงสัมพันธ์พร้อมแล้วกับปัญหาดังกล่าว คุณต้องหาทางเลือกอื่นที่เหมาะสม ด้วยเหตุผลดังกล่าว คุณสามารถเลือกฐานข้อมูล MongoDB ซึ่งมาพร้อมกับคุณสมบัติการเฟลโอเวอร์และความพร้อมใช้งานสูง ไม่จำเป็นต้องมีเครื่องมือเพิ่มเติมเพื่อใช้คุณลักษณะเหล่านี้ การใช้ฐานข้อมูล MongoDB ถือว่ามีประสิทธิภาพสูงและเรียบง่ายด้วยเหตุผลหลักสองประการนี้ ด้วยฐานข้อมูล MySQL คุณจะได้รับสิ่งพิเศษ แม้จะเป็นแพลตฟอร์มฐานข้อมูลเชิงสัมพันธ์ แต่ก็มาพร้อมกับคุณสมบัติเหล่านี้เนื่องจากมีคลัสเตอร์ Galera อย่างไรก็ตาม หากคุณต้องการหลีกเลี่ยงฐานข้อมูลเชิงสัมพันธ์ แพลตฟอร์มฐานข้อมูล MongoDB อาจเป็นทางเลือกที่ดีที่สุดสำหรับคุณ

  1. การทำให้เป็นมาตรฐานของฐานข้อมูล

เมื่อต้องเลือกแพลตฟอร์มการจัดการฐานข้อมูลที่เหมาะสม คุณต้องมองหาคุณสมบัติบางประการ ในบรรดาคุณสมบัติเหล่านั้น การทำให้เป็นมาตรฐานถือเป็นหนึ่งในคุณสมบัติชั้นนำ ด้วยแพลตฟอร์มฐานข้อมูลเชิงสัมพันธ์ การทำให้เป็นมาตรฐานถือเป็นพื้นที่ของปัญหา การทำให้เป็นมาตรฐานต้องทำด้วยความสมบูรณ์แบบ เพื่อจุดประสงค์นั้น แพลตฟอร์มฐานข้อมูลเชิงสัมพันธ์จะไม่ทำงานได้ดีที่สุด คุณต้องหาทางเลือกอื่น และด้วยเหตุนั้น การทำให้เป็นมาตรฐานจึงเป็นตัวเลือกที่ดีที่สุดสำหรับคุณ ทำให้กระบวนการจัดการข้อมูลง่ายขึ้น การประมวลผลข้อมูล การจัดเก็บข้อมูล การจัดเรียงข้อมูล และคุณลักษณะอื่นๆ ของข้อมูลมีความสำคัญ ด้วยเหตุผลดังกล่าว คุณต้องพิจารณาปัจจัยการทำให้เป็นมาตรฐาน

  1. คุณสมบัติเพิ่มเติมบางประการของฐานข้อมูล MongoDB

ในส่วนต่อไปนี้ จะมีการกล่าวถึงคุณลักษณะเพิ่มเติมบางประการของฐานข้อมูล MongoDB นี่คือคุณสมบัติเหล่านั้นสำหรับคุณในส่วนต่อไปนี้

  • ด้วยฐานข้อมูล MongoDB แอปพลิเคชันบนเซิร์ฟเวอร์จะมีประสิทธิภาพที่ดีขึ้นและราบรื่นยิ่งขึ้น ไม่จำเป็นต้องทำให้ข้อมูลเป็นมาตรฐาน และนั่นคือสาเหตุที่ทำให้ประสิทธิภาพของแอปพลิเคชันเหมาะสมที่สุด
  • ด้วยฐานข้อมูล MongoDB แอปพลิเคชันจะมีประสิทธิภาพที่ดีขึ้นในการนำเสนอ สามารถทำให้ชุดเรพลิกาทำงานได้อย่างง่ายดาย
  • ด้วยแพลตฟอร์มฐานข้อมูลนี้ การพัฒนาผลิตภัณฑ์ได้เร็วขึ้นสามารถทำได้ ในกรณีนี้ไม่จำเป็นต้องมีการโยกย้ายสคีมา
  • ด้วย MongoDB จะมีการดูแลระบบที่ต่ำกว่า นี่เป็นอีกหนึ่งคุณลักษณะเด่น เนื่องจากทำให้แพลตฟอร์มฐานข้อมูลง่ายขึ้นสำหรับการตั้งค่า เมื่อเทียบกับฐานข้อมูลเชิงสัมพันธ์ มันทำให้ MongoDB เป็นตัวเลือกที่ดีกว่า

ด้วยเหตุผลทั้งหมดนี้ การเลือกฐานข้อมูล MongoDB แทนฐานข้อมูลเชิงสัมพันธ์จึงเป็นสิ่งที่ดีเสมอ